Developing Your DJ Skills
Start with the basics before you try to get fancy. Developing essential DJing skills like beatmatching and phrasing is non-negotiable in 2026. Phrasing isn’t just about timing. It’s about understanding the 32-beat structure of a track to ensure your transitions feel seamless and intentional. Once you’ve mastered the blend, you can start enhancing your sets with effects and loops to create a signature sound. Don’t overdo it. A great DJ knows when to let the music breathe and when to add that extra boost. ⚡ Improve your skills every day.
Choosing the Right Gear
Beginners often get overwhelmed by gear costs, but you don’t need a 35,000 lei club setup to start your journey. Entry-level controllers are more capable than ever. Consider these budget-friendly options:
- Pioneer DDJ REV 1: 1,548 lei. Great for learning the industry-standard layout.
- Numark Mixtrack Platinum FX: 1,510 lei. Offers excellent jog wheel displays.
- Dap Audio CORE Kontrol D1: 989 lei. A solid entry point for those on a tight budget.
While these controllers are perfect for home practice, you’ll eventually need to step up to professional equipment. Most venues in Timișoara use Pioneer CDJs and DJM mixers. Remember to keep your library organized. Use Rekordbox to analyze your tracks and prepare your 32GB USB sticks. Having your hot cues and memory points set up before you arrive at the venue makes a world of difference. When you’re prepared, you can focus on the crowd instead of the screen. Preparing for a Recording Session
Don’t just hit record and wing it. A professional session requires a plan. Start by selecting tracks that define your signature style but also fit the vibe of the clubs you’re targeting. Use Rekordbox to ensure your library is analyzed and your hot cues are set. A cohesive 60-minute set with a clear narrative arc is much more effective than a random collection of bangers. Test your levels before you start. There’s nothing worse than finishing a perfect performance only to find the audio is clipping. 🚀 Bring your passion to life with a flawless recording.

Live streaming from home can be risky. Between unstable internet and the 1,500 lei fine for noise complaints under Law 61/1991, your bedroom isn’t always the best studio. Furthermore, using personal streaming accounts for public performance is illegal in Romania. Platforms like Mixcloud handle licensing with UCMR-ADA and UPFR automatically, which is a massive advantage. What equipment should a beginner DJ in Timișoara invest in?
Invest in a Pioneer DDJ-FLX4, which currently retails for approximately 1,599 lei at major Romanian music retailers. This controller introduces you to the Rekordbox ecosystem, which is used by 95% of the festival circuit. You’ll also need a reliable pair of Sennheiser HD-25 headphones, costing around 750 lei, and a 32GB USB 3.0 stick. How do I record a professional DJ set?
Record your audio directly into Rekordbox or use a dedicated hardware recorder like the Zoom H1n, which costs about 500 lei, for the cleanest signal. Keep your gain levels out of the red to avoid digital clipping that can ruin a perfect mix. For maximum impact, sync your audio with 4K video.
